My Story

I'm a mother of two in Taiwan — and I remember both my pregnancies with a clarity that surprises me now. The first-trimester nausea that made brushing my teeth an ordeal. The anatomy scan where I couldn't breathe until the sonographer said everything looked fine. The third-trimester insomnia that no pillow arrangement could fix.

Pregnancy Guide exists because I want expecting moms to have clear, evidence-based answers without wading through medical jargon, fear-based marketing, or content that feels written by someone who's never been pregnant.

Before motherhood I taught young kids English for years, and trained in mindset and personal-growth work. Both shaped how I write here — breaking complex science into bite-sized steps, and remembering that information is only useful if it lands at the right emotional moment. Every article here references ACOG, CDC, and WHO guidelines, combined with the kind of honest, mom-to-mom context you actually need.

And that's how Pregnancy Guide was born.

Pregnancy Guide runs on display ads only (Google AdSense). I don't accept paid placements, sponsored posts, or pay-for-review deals. All content is informational only, not medical advice. For anything affecting your pregnancy, always consult your OB/GYN, midwife, or healthcare provider.

Medical disclaimer

I'm not a medical professional. Everything on this site is for informational purposes only and should not replace guidance from your OB/GYN, midwife, or healthcare provider. When in doubt, ask your care team.

When I'm wrong

Medical guidelines evolve. If you spot something outdated, please email me — every article shows a "Last reviewed" date so you can see what's current.
